Key Responsibilities:
* Procure construction materials, equipment, and services as per project requirements.
* Identify, evaluate, and negotiate with vendors and suppliers for the best pricing and quality.
* Prepare and process Purchase Orders (POs) and ensure timely delivery of materials.
* Maintain inventory levels and coordinate with site engineers and project managers.
* Compare quotations, conduct rate analysis, and finalize vendor selection.
* Monitor material consumption and prevent shortages at project sites.
* Develop and maintain strong relationships with suppliers and contractors.
* Ensure procurement activities comply with company policies and project budgets.
* Prepare purchase reports, cost-saving analyses, and vendor performance evaluations.
* Coordinate with accounts for invoice verification and payment processing.
